If the Employee has remained continuously in a Business Relationship from the Grant Date through the dates listed on the vesting schedule set forth on the cover page hereof, the Employee may exercise this option for the number of shares of Common Stock in accordance with such vesting schedule.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the Board may, in its discretion, accelerate the date that any installment of this option becomes exercisable. The foregoing rights are cumulative and (subject to Sections 4 or 5 hereof if the Employees Business Relationship terminates) may be exercised only before the date which is 10 years from the Grant Date.
The terms and conditions pursuant to which an Option vests in the Participant and becomes exercisable shall be determined by the Administrator and set forth in the applicable Award Agreement. Such vesting may be based on service with the Company or any Affiliate, any of the Performance Criteria, or any other criteria selected by the Administrator. At any time after the grant of an Option, the Administrator may, in its sole discretion and subject to whatever terms and conditions it selects, accelerate the vesting of the Option.

So long as the Optionee continues to be an Eligible Individual performing bona fide services to or for the Company through the applicable vesting date(s) below (each, a Vesting Date), the Option shall become vested and exercisable pursuant to the following schedule:
The vesting schedule applicable to the Option requires continued employment or service through each applicable vesting date as a condition to the vesting of the applicable installment of the Option and the rights and benefits under this Option Agreement. Employment or service for only a portion of the vesting period, even if a substantial portion, will not entitle the Grantee to any proportionate vesting or avoid or mitigate a termination of rights and benefits upon or following a termination of employment or services as provided in [Section 5] below or under the Plan.
Vesting of Option Right. The Option may be exercised by the Participant under the following schedule except as otherwise provided in this Agreement. The Option may not be exercised for a period of one (1) year from the Grant Date. Following that one-year period, the Option vests and becomes exercisable in equal one-third increments: one-third vests on the one-year anniversary of the Grant Date; one-third vests on the two-year anniversary of the Grant Date; and one-third vests on the three-year anniversary of the Grant Date. Vesting Schedule: [Note: Company to elect vesting schedule; following is an example of a standard vesting provision] This Option shall become exercisable for 25% of the maximum number of shares granted on the first anniversary of the Vesting Start Date, and shall become exercisable for an additional 2.0833% of the maximum number of shares granted on the last day of each one month period thereafter; so that the Option shall be fully vested on the fourth anniversary of the Vesting Start Date. All vesting shall cease upon the date of termination of employment.

Vesting. A Stock Option shall become vested and nonforfeitable as determined by the Administrator at the time of grant and set forth in the applicable option agreement, provided that no Stock Option shall become vested earlier than the first anniversary of the date of grant of such Stock Option; and provided, further, that the Participant shall have continuously remained in the active employment of the Company or an Affiliate until the applicable vesting date.
